The 'Don Row Doctrine' and Cartel Crackdown

  • 🚀 The "Don Row Doctrine," an extension of the Monroe Doctrine, is introduced as President Trump's strategy to combat drug trafficking nations.
  • ⚠️ Four nations – Mexico, Venezuela, Colombia, and Ecuador – are identified as deeply involved in drug trafficking, causing widespread death and destruction.
  • 🚢 The U.S. has deployed significant military assets, including the USS Gerald Ford carrier strike group and 15,000 troops, to the Caribbean to pressure these nations.
  • 💰 Trump's designation of drug cartels as terrorists allows for military action without congressional approval, a move Bill O'Reilly supports as the only way to solve the problem.
  • 🇺🇸 The U.S. is criticized for its role in enriching cartels through drug consumption, with over 500,000 overdose deaths in five years and a lenient approach to drug addicts.

Robert O'Neill's Defamation Lawsuit

  • 🎯 Former Navy SEAL Robert O'Neill is suing two podcast hosts, Brent Tucker and Tyler Hoover, for defamation.
  • 🗣️ The hosts claim O'Neill, credited with killing Osama bin Laden, is a fraud and lied about his role in the raid.
  • 💔 O'Neill is pursuing the lawsuit because the accusations have caused significant emotional distress to his college-age daughters.
  • 🎖️ O'Neill, a highly decorated SEAL, emphasizes the importance of standing up to bullies and the need for accountability in the podcasting world.
  • ⚖️ The legal battle is expected to be lengthy and costly, with O'Neill hiring a firm to represent him and receiving support from figures like Admiral Bill McCraven.
